Default andrews 31h cams

anyone running a 31 grind andrews . on paper it looks like it should fill the hole between the 26 stock bagger cam and the 37 cam which leaves a little to much off the bottom end for a heavy bagger imo .opinions please.

While trying to find a cam for my 07 FLSRC I have come to a little knowledge on cams.
If you look at the 46*ATDC intake closing on the 31 cam I believe that would even raise the power band even higher in the RPM range than the 37's which is 38* and the 26's have a 35* closing.
From what I have learned reading below 35* ATDC intake closing give more low-mid tq
for the heavier bikes, so it would seem the 31 cam would be worse than even the 37's for making low-mid tq.

I would have to agree with oct1949. Stock compression is somewhere around 9:1. In that case closing the intake around 30* will make optimum low end torque but will suffer at rpms over 5000. If you are like me and have the rev-limiter set at 5300 or less and are looking for some real usable torque between 2200 and 3000 to compliment the 6 speed, you are not going to like the 31 in a stock bike. I personally wouldn't try a 31 unless I was pushing something like 10.5:1 compression.
